Webasto develops retractable hardtop for Corvette convertible

Webasto developed the new, custom-made two-part retractable hardtop for the re-imagined Stingray, with a total of six electric motors fitted in the roof in place of a hydraulic system.

Webasto, the global market leader for roof systems, is collaborating with Chevrolet on the groundbreaking Corvette Stingray. The re-imagined, mid-engine Corvette will feature a retractable hardtop convertible for the first time in its 67-year history. Developed by Webasto, the innovative roof system is assembled in Plymouth, Michigan.
